Prelude rims fit integra?
Will a set of rims that came off of a 93 prelude fit on a 94 integra?

Nope, wont fit, 92-96 preludes and accord's have a 114.4mm 4 lug bolt patern.... Civic's and integras have a 100mm 4 lug bolt pattern.
